2012-06-27 27 views
0

假設活動樹有兩個活動(活動1和活動2)。活動1的cmi.exit默認設置爲空字符串,活動2的cmi.exit設置爲「掛起」,「adl.nav.request」設置爲「exitAll」,然後Activity 2調用Terminate(「」)。我想知道是否可以在下一個排序會話中訪問活動2的運行環境數據模型中的當前信息,或者丟棄這些數據。cmi.exit數據模型元素

回答

1

「exitAll」終止排序會話,根本不保存任何數據。所以,下一個排序會話將以新數據開始。爲了能夠在下一個排序會話中檢索數據,您需要調用「suspendAll」。當「cmi.exit」設置爲掛起時,掛起活動的當前狀態將被保存並在同一個排序會話中可用,但除非您調用「suspendAll」,否則在下一個排序會話中將不可用。